This summer in Children’s Worship we have been storytelling through the book of Acts. From our theme verse, Ephesians 2:22, we have asked, “If our body is a house where God lives through their Spirit, what does my body know about God? What does the Holy Spirit sound like, feel like, in my body? And how then should I treat you if you, too, are a house where God lives?”
In the past two weeks we have been eavesdropping on Paul’s letters to the early church as they shared evidence and experience, trying to figure out exactly what this Spirit was. How delightful to pull out these discoveries in a room full of children themselves discovering what all this means. The Holy Spirit comes to all kinds of bodies! The Holy Spirit helps us when we are weak! The Holy Spirit makes us brave! The Holy Spirit is always whispering, reminding us we are beloved children of God! And even when we don’t know what to ask God, the Holy Spirit inside of us knows, and groans in secret messages straight into God’s ear. Wow!
